00:08The UAE government has announced the establishment of a legal system for venture capital funds.
00:14The move comes as part of the first batch of government accelerator projects launched
00:18last year by His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President and
00:23Prime Minister of the UAE and ruler of Dubai.
00:26Removing the fine print governing venture capital funds is the result of a strong partnership
00:31between the public and private sector, said Sultan bin Saeed Al Mansouri, Minister of
00:36Economy.
00:37A senior member of the Israeli embassy staff in the UK was secretly filmed saying he wanted
00:42to take down Foreign Office Minister Sir Alan Duncan. Sir Alan, who has been critical of
00:47Israel, was seen as more of a problem than Foreign Secretary Boris Johnson, who was quote
00:53unquote, basically good, according to a transcript of the conversation.
00:57He just doesn't care. He's an idiot, but has become Minister of Foreign Affairs without
01:02any responsibilities, says the transcript.
01:05In sport, Novak Djokovic brought world number one Andy Murray's 28-match winning streak
01:10to an end in Doha last night to retain the Qatar Open title in a three-set thriller.
01:15Djokovic won 6-3, 5-7, 6-4 in an action-packed match between the two best players in the
01:22world lasting almost three hours.
01:26Hollywood's elite head for the red carpet tonight for the Golden Globes, the launch
01:29of the entertainment industry's awards season.
01:32Leading the pack this year is Damien Chazelle's La La Land, a nostalgic tribute to the golden
01:37age of Hollywood musicals that picked up seven nominations.
01:41Barry Jenkins' coming-of-age tale Moonlight got six nominations, including for the director
01:46and cast members Naomi Harris and Mahershala Ali.
